My trip to Qinghai wouldn't have been complete without visiting the legendary Sun Moon Mountain, or Riyue Shan. This isn't just any mountain; it's a place steeped in history and natural beauty, offering a truly unique experience when you travel China. Located about 100 kilometers southwest of Xining, it serves as a natural boundary, historically marking the division between the Han Chinese agricultural lands and the nomadic pastures of Tibet. As I ascended, I could really feel the shift in landscape and culture. The eastern slope, facing Xining, felt lush and green, characteristic of the inland plains. But as you cross the pass and look westward, towards Qinghai Lake, the scenery transforms into the vast, expansive grasslands, hinting at the Tibetan plateau. It's truly a geographic marvel! This divide is why it's called Sun Moon Mountain – legend has it that Princess Wencheng, on her way to marry the Tibetan King Songtsen Gampo during the Tang Dynasty, looked back at her homeland for the last time here. She threw a mirror, which shattered into two pieces, becoming the Sun and Moon, symbolizing her bittersweet journey. You can even see monuments dedicated to her story, like the Princess Wencheng Temple, which adds a poignant layer to the visit. When planning your own adventure to Riyue Shan, I'd recommend going during the warmer months, from late spring to early autumn (May to October), when the weather is milder and the grasslands are vibrant. However, even in winter, the snow-capped peaks offer a dramatic, albeit chilly, beauty. Getting there is quite straightforward from Xining; many local tours include it, or you can hire a private car. It’s often combined with a visit to Qinghai Lake, which makes for a perfect day trip. Don't forget to bring layers, as the weather can change quickly at altitude, and definitely pack some snacks and water.
